The Essence of Crystal Value

Various crystals including amethyst and rose quartz with price tags

Crystals embody worth both in the metaphysical and material realms. Spiritually, they are believed to enhance energies, aid emotional healing, and attract positive energies. Materially, their valuation is shaped by rarity, demand, color, clarity, size, and artistry.

Crystals such as clear quartz, amethyst, and rose quartz remain popular due to their symbolic significance and market demand. Meanwhile, rarer stones like moldavite, phenakite, or tanzanite can command high prices due to their scarcity and desire.

2025 Crystal Value Chart: A Glimpse by Type

Below is an overview of the value of some common and rare crystals in 2025:

Crystal Type

Price per Carat (2025)

Notes

Amethyst

$5 to $50+

Deeper purple shades have higher value

Clear Quartz

$1 to $10

Abundant yet highly coveted

Rose Quartz

$2 to $15

Favored for love energies

Citrine

$10 to $30

Natural citrine valued over heat-treated

Black Tourmaline

$5 to $25

Known for protective properties

Moldavite

$20 to $300+

Rare, origin in meteoric impact

Tanzanite

$50 to $400+

Exceptionally rare gem

Selenite

$3 to $10

Fragile yet spiritually significant

Lapis Lazuli

$10 to $50+

Distinctive royal blue with gold flecks

Tiger*s Eye

$3 to $15

Grounding and protective qualities

Influences on Crystal Valuation

1. Type & Rarity

Crystals like moldavite, phenakite, and tanzanite are priced highly due to their limited availability.

2. Color & Clarity

Stones with vibrant, consistent colors and clear, inclusion-free surfaces are highly prized.

3. Size & Weight

Larger crystals or clusters are often more valuable, particularly if they maintain color and clarity.

4. Origin & Source

Crystals sourced from regions known for superior quality (such as Brazilian amethyst or Himalayan quartz) often command higher prices.

5. Shape & Finish

  • Raw stones are generally more affordable.

  • Polished, faceted, or carved stones require skilled labor, adding to their cost.

  • Jewelry settings significantly increase value.

3. Be Cautious of Imitations

Some crystals are dyed, synthetically created, or even plastic. Signs of imitations include:

  • Overly uniform or fluorescent color

  • Lightweight or glass-like texture

  • Prices too low for the stated type
